Pumpkin Oatmeal Chocolate Chip Cookies

Indulge in the perfect fall treat: Pumpkin Oatmeal Chocolate Chip Cookies. Soft, chewy, and absolutely delightful.

Ingredients

  • 2 1/4 cup All-purpose flour
  • 1 tsp Baking soda
  • 3 tsp Pumpkin pie spice
  • 1/4 tsp Salt
  • 1 cup Unsalted butter 2 sticks
  • 1 1/4 cup Light brown sugar
  • 1/2 cup Cane sugar - can use granulated sugar
  • 1 cup Pumpkin puree gently pressed between two paper towels to remove some moisture
  • 1 Egg yolk only
  • 1 tsp Vanilla extract
  • 1 1/2 cups Rolled oats or old-fashioned oats
  • 1 cup Chocolate chips

Instructions

  • Preheat the oven to 350 and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
  • Combine the flour, baking soda, pumpkin pie spice, and salt in a small bowl. Set aside.
  • Gently press the pumpkin puree between a couple of paper towels to remove some of the moisture.
  • In a large bowl, cream your butter, light brown sugar, and cane sugar together until light and fluffy.
  • Add in the pumpkin puree, egg, and vanilla. Mix until combined.
  • Now, add in the dry ingredients and mix until just combined.
  • Fold in the rolled oats and chocolate chips until everything comes together.
  • Scoop the cookie dough onto a lined baking sheet using a cookie scoop. Don't overcrowd your cookie sheet. Bake the cookies for 10-12 minutes.
  • Transfer baked cookies to a wire cooling rack and let them cool completely. Enjoy!
